                                                   ABSTRACT     This research is entitled “Prefixes of Verbs and Nouns in English and Saluan Language: A Contrastive Analysis”. The aims of this study are to identify, classify, and analyze about the form, function, and meaning of prefix of verbs and nouns in English and Saluan Language, and to find out the similarities and differences of both language by using the theory of Brinton (2010), O’Grady & Dobrovolsky (1992), and Brown (1980). In this study, the English data were taken from the book of O’Grady (1992) and Oxford Learner’s Dictionary, fourth edition by Oxford University Press (2008) The data Saluan language were taken from informants. The result of this study shows that both languages have differences and similarities. Prefix of nouns in Saluan language consist topo-, nong-, pong-, and ka-. Based on function, Prefix of verbs and nouns in English can be attached to verbs, nouns, and adjective. Prefix of verbs and nouns in Saluan Language can be attached to verbs, nouns, adjective, and numerial. The simillarities English and Saluan Languages have the prefixes of verbs and nouns. The difference between the two languages is that the English prefix of nouns only attached to the basis of nouns, while prefix in Saluan language is attached to the verbs and nouns.Key words: Prefixes in English and Saluan Language, Contrastive Analysis.

                                                    ABSTRACT     This research entitled "Ekspresi Sosial yang Digunakan oleh Mahasiswa Jurusan Sastra Inggris di Kelas Daring Analisis Wacana". This research focuses on identifying and classifying the social expressions and the functions of social expressions, as well as analyzing and describing the language styles of English Department students in the Discourse Analysis online class. These expressions were used by studentsto respond the lecturer and communicate with theirfriends during the Discourse Analysis online class. The data were taken from 2 classes of Discourse Analysis via Zoom and Whatsapp group. This research uses theories of Kirkpatrick (2008) which aims to identify, classify, and the functions of social expressions; and Joss (1978) which aims to analyze and describe the language styles. To ensure the data collection process, the writer uses descriptive method. The results of this research shows that there only 10 of 30 types of social expressions, namely special greetings, greeting people, asking permission, giving thanks, giving warning, offering help, expressing uncertainty, apologizing, saying goodbye, and telling time and dates. The functions of social expressions that are used by the students, namely: the function of special greetings is a hope that the person is fine, successful, lucky, and so on; the function of greeting people as an informal alternative to hello! when you meetsomeone; the function of asking permission is you ask permission to do something; the function of giving thanks is a form of response to someone thanking you for something; the functions of giving warning is put up by someone who does not want other people going on their land without permission; the function of offering help is someone offers to help you with something; the function of expressing uncertainty when you do not know whether something is true or you have doubts about something; the function of apologizing is you wish to apologize to someone for something bad, unpleasant, inconvenient, etc that you have done; the function of say goodbye is you leave someone or when they leave you; and the function of tell times dan dates was you want to know the time. In terms of language styles, there are 4 of 5 levels of style that are used, those are: formal style, consultative style, casual or formal style, and intimate style. Formal style usually follows a commonly accepted format, impersonal and formal, there are 34 language styles of social expression used by English Department students in Discourse Analysis online class. Consultative style is used for someone to consult with someone, two or many people who have problem to consultancy. In this part, there are 6 language styles of social expression used by the students. Casual or informal style is used to communicate each other whether in chat or talking directly, there are 3 language styles of social expression used by the students in Discourse Analysis online class. Intimate style is used for closed people to get several information or others that are 2 secret with an intimate people. In this part, there are 13 language styles of social expression used by English Department students in Discourse Analysis online class.Key words: Social Expressions, English Department Students, Discourse Analysis Online Class

                                                     ABSTRACT     The tittle of this skripsi is “Campur Kode yang Digunakan dalam Acara Talk Show Kick Andy di Metro TV”. It is analyzed from the sociolinguistic point of view. The aims of this research are to identify, classify, and analyze the code-mixing used by the host, Andy F. Noya, and his guest stars in the program “Kick Andy” (Talk show program on Metro TV). The research uses qualitative descriptive approach, by using the theory of Hoffman (1991:112) and Kim (2006: 43). The data were collected from utterances containing code-mixing in English by Andy F. Noya and the guest stars, in video / 14 episodes. The total number of code-mixing found are 120 by Andy F. Noya and guest stars in “Kick Andy” talk show program on Metro TV. The results of this research show that two types of code-mixing found are intra sentential code-mixing and intra lexical code-mixing. While the type of involving a change of pronunciation is not found in the data. The results of this research also show that there are 5 of 6 factors that cause people to do code-mixing in “Kick Andy” talk show program on Metro TV, namely bilingualism, speaker and partner speaking, social community, situation, and vocabulary. However, the factor of prestige is not found in the data.Keywords: Code-Mixing, “Kick Andy” talk show program, Sociolinguistics.

                                                     ABSTRACT     This research entitled “Penggunaan Ujaran dan Ekspresi Emosional dalam Mengekspresikan Kemarahan dalam Film Joker Karya Todd Phillips (Analisis Psikolinguistik). This research focuses on identifying and classifying the utterances in expressing anger, and analyzing the emotional expressions. There are two types of communiactios, which are verbal communication and non verbal communication. Utterances are the verbal communication while the emotional expression is the nonverbal communication. The form of the utterance divided into several, such as emotive speech, phatic speech, conative speech, referential speech, metalingual speech, and phoetic speech. Emotional expressions that can be realized are facial expressions, voice, gesture, and posture. Face and voice can describe a person’s emotional state. It can be extinguished between people who are in a state of emotion and the other from a change of voice and facial expressions. The gesture and posture are physical actions appear to communicate a certain message. The researcher used descriptive method in order to find out the use of utterance and emotional expressions in film Joker as the data supported by Jakobson (1960) and Plutchik’s (2003) theory. The results of this research show that the utterances that express the anger can be seen in the act of speech by the characters, such as emotive speech, conative speech, and referential speech. While the emotional expression can be seen in several ways, such as face expressions, posture and gesture, tone of voice, physiological changes, and emotional actions, like the eyes staring intently at someone, frowning forehead, squinting or bulging eyes, hold the gun, lips tightly closed, jaws tighten, high and firm tone of voice, sweating, shouting, punching at each other in the face, index finger pointing, body leaning and stiff.-------------------------------------------------------Keywords : Utterances, Emotional Expression, Anger, Film Joker, Psycholinguistics
